Output 75a570d80552e2802184f527354e167fbe5c55232cd5fd30ec570e0436447ed7:8

value
3540024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b953165ba96c966cb03d3be36c1d97b98a05860 OP_EQUAL
address
3QdGFoT6MSqWVFm7qUDt5EnvF1eWMhjj9g
transaction
75a570d80552e2802184f527354e167fbe5c55232cd5fd30ec570e0436447ed7
spent
true